- Introduction to Polyimide Film in Solar Panel Production

Polyimide film, a versatile and efficient material, is garnering attention in the solar panel production industry for its ability to contribute to more efficient processes. With the global shift towards renewable energy sources, the demand for solar panels has been steadily increasing, prompting manufacturers to explore new materials and technologies to improve production efficiency and reduce costs.

Polyimide film, a type of polymer film known for its high temperature resistance, mechanical strength, and chemical stability, is well-suited for use in solar panel production. Its unique properties make it an ideal candidate for various applications in the manufacturing process, from protecting sensitive electronic components to providing insulation and adhesion properties.

One key benefit of using polyimide film in solar panel production is its high temperature resistance. Solar panels are exposed to various environmental conditions, including high temperatures, which can affect their performance and efficiency. By incorporating polyimide film into the production process, manufacturers can ensure that the panels are able to withstand extreme temperatures without compromising their functionality.

In addition to its thermal properties, polyimide film also offers excellent mechanical strength, making it suitable for use in various components of solar panels. From protecting fragile components during assembly to providing structural support, polyimide film plays a crucial role in ensuring the durability and longevity of solar panels.

Furthermore, polyimide film is chemically stable, which means it does not degrade or react with other materials over time. This makes it an ideal material for use in solar panel production, where long-term stability and reliability are essential. The chemical stability of polyimide film ensures that the panels remain in optimal condition throughout their lifespan, contributing to their overall efficiency and performance.

- Benefits of Using Polyimide Film for Solar Panel Manufacturing

Polyimide film is a versatile material that has been gaining popularity in the manufacturing of solar panels due to its numerous benefits. This innovative material offers a range of advantages that contribute to more efficient production processes, ultimately leading to improved performance and durability of solar panels.

One of the key benefits of using polyimide film in solar panel manufacturing is its exceptional thermal stability. Solar panels are constantly exposed to high temperatures and harsh environmental conditions, making heat resistance a crucial factor in their design. Polyimide film has a high heat resistance, allowing it to withstand extreme temperatures without degrading or losing its integrity. This property ensures that solar panels remain reliable and efficient for extended periods of time, ultimately reducing maintenance costs and increasing overall lifespan.

In addition to its thermal stability, polyimide film also offers excellent chemical resistance. Solar panels are often exposed to a variety of chemicals and environmental pollutants, which can degrade the materials and decrease their efficiency over time. Polyimide film is resistant to a wide range of chemicals, making it an ideal choice for solar panel manufacturing in areas with high levels of pollution or industrial activity. This resistance helps to protect the panels from corrosion and deterioration, ensuring they maintain their performance for years to come.

Another benefit of using polyimide film in solar panel manufacturing is its flexibility and durability. Traditional materials used in solar panel production, such as glass, can be brittle and prone to cracking or breaking under stress. Polyimide film, on the other hand, is highly flexible and durable, making it less likely to shatter or fail under pressure. This flexibility allows for easier handling and installation of solar panels, reducing the risk of damage during transportation and installation.

Furthermore, polyimide film is also lightweight, which can help to reduce the overall weight of solar panels and lower shipping costs. The lighter weight of polyimide film makes it easier to transport and install solar panels, ultimately saving time and money during the production process. Additionally, the lightweight nature of polyimide film can also help to reduce the structural requirements of solar panel frames, further lowering production costs and increasing efficiency.

- Challenges and Considerations for Implementing Polyimide Film

Polyimide film has been gaining traction as a potential solution to improving the efficiency of solar panel production. As the demand for renewable energy sources continues to rise, it is crucial to find innovative ways to streamline the manufacturing process. However, implementing polyimide film comes with its own set of challenges and considerations that need to be carefully addressed.

One of the key benefits of using polyimide film in solar panel production is its high heat resistance. With a high glass transition temperature, polyimide film can withstand the high temperatures required during the manufacturing process without degrading. This is particularly important in the lamination stage, where the solar cells are encapsulated in protective layers. By using polyimide film, manufacturers can ensure that the solar panels retain their efficacy and longevity, even in extreme weather conditions.

Another advantage of polyimide film is its flexibility and durability. Unlike traditional materials such as glass or metal, polyimide film can be easily molded to fit the shape of the solar panels, allowing for more efficient use of space and materials. This flexibility also makes polyimide film more resistant to cracking and breaking, reducing the risk of damage during installation or transportation.

Despite these benefits, there are several challenges that need to be addressed when implementing polyimide film in solar panel production. One major concern is the cost of the material. Polyimide film is generally more expensive than traditional materials, such as glass or metal. This can be a significant barrier for manufacturers looking to adopt this technology, especially smaller companies with limited budgets.

Furthermore, the manufacturing process for polyimide film can be complex and requires specialized equipment and expertise. This can add to the initial investment required to switch to polyimide film, as well as the ongoing maintenance and training costs. Manufacturers will need to carefully weigh the potential benefits of using polyimide film against these additional expenses to determine if it is a cost-effective solution for their operations.

In addition to cost considerations, there are also environmental concerns to be aware of when using polyimide film. While polyimide itself is a relatively inert material, the production process can involve the use of chemicals and solvents that may be harmful to the environment if not properly managed. Manufacturers will need to implement strict safety protocols and waste management practices to ensure that the production of polyimide film does not have a negative impact on the environment.
